9.3 Response time of the ET 200PA SMART
Definition of response time
The response time is the time between detection of an input signal and the modification of a
linked output signal.
Duration
The response time depends on the bus configuration and on the DP master.
Factors
The response time for the ET 200PA SMART depends on the following factors:
Processing of the data by the ET 200PA SMART
Delay of the inputs and outputs (refer to the "S7-300 automation system, module
specifications (
http://support.automation.siemens.com/WW/view/en/8859629)" Reference
Manual.
